Handover: Pedalshift rebalancer. Taking over from me is Ivo; reviewer, please check the truck-assignment loop in dispatch.go — it still double-counts docks at the Harrowgate hub during the 6am sweep. Tests pass but the fixture data is stale. Cron runs every 20 minutes; don't change that before the Velora city pilot ends. Redis keys are namespaced per depot now. The staging values below reflect what the rebalancer currently runs with.

deployment values, yadug-bawif:
[framir]
team = pelox
access_code = ac_a38ab2
owner = tamion.julael
host = framir.tolvaqlabs.test
port = 11211
peer = tammir.zemvargrid.local
salt = 2215ef03
pin = 1541

**Action item (P1): Fix cursor pagination in Lumora public API.** During the Oct incident, clients hammering /v2/listings with offset pagination caused deep scans that pinned the primary. We're moving to opaque cursors with enforced page caps. On-call: if latency on list endpoints spikes again, check cursor decode errors first, then throttle per-key. Do not raise the max page size as a mitigation — that's what melted us last time. The agreed tuning constants are as follows.

constants for bawif-kawif:
QUOTAS = {
    "ulaael": 5,
    "holael": 10,
}

Welcome aboard. You'll be working on Fenwick Search's autocomplete index, which has been rebuilding slowly since the prefix-trie refactor. Nightly rebuilds currently take six hours; the target is under two. Profiling notes live in the perf folder of the searchcore repo. When you're ready to deploy a rebuild candidate to staging, sign the artifact with the indexer deploy key below.

rollout seal: bky4_x7Gc

Minutes – Management Meeting, Delacourt Fabrications

The committee considered the joint venture proposal from Ryhope Marine Systems regarding shared production at the Windmere yard. Mr. Pellant summarised commercial terms; Ms. Ashgrove raised concerns about intellectual property licensing and exit provisions. It was resolved to commission independent valuation of contributed assets and to defer a decision until the next board meeting. The confidential note on business plans relevant to this matter is appended below.

board note of kagep-yahig: Only 9 of the 120 pilot accounts renewed Quenix, so a churn review is set for April 1.